Key differences

ISSB is an alternative ETF, while CGCB is a fixed income ETF. ISSB charges 1.14% a year and CGCB 0.27%.

  • ISSB is an alternative fund, while CGCB is a fixed income fund. They carry different risk/return profiles.
  • ISSB follows a option income strategy; CGCB uses active selection.
  • CGCB costs 0.87% less per year.
  • CGCB is much larger than ISSB. Larger funds are usually more liquid and less likely to close.
